San antonio botanical gardens - A large and diverse offering, very enjoyable. The SA Botanical Garden is a relatively large attraction and you will want to plan on at least a couple of hours. Some of our favorite areas include the Lucile Halsell Conservatory Area (including the 4 pavilions surrounding it), the Texas Narrative Trail and the Overlook.

Nov 17, 2022 · The San Antonio Botanical Garden is a rolling topography with spectacular views of downtown San Antonio spread over 38 acres. The botanical garden opened in 1980 and is located about three miles northeast of downtown. The landscape comprises different formal garden displays that connect with curving pathways. Founded in 1980, the San Antonio Botanical Garden is a 38-acre property that once was the site of a former limestone quarry and waterworks owned by the city. San Antonio Garden Center is a council comprised of more than two dozen local non-profit organizations and nationally federated garden clubs. Founded in 1940 and headquartered in a building owned by the Witte Museum, Garden Center eventually opened its own building in its current location across from Mancke Park in 1960.Endangered Plants. With more than 20,000 native plants in the U.S., fully one-fourth of them live in Texas. The 11-acre Texas Native Trail represents three ecological regions of Texas: Hill Country, East Texas Pineywoods, and South Texas Plains.To locate and/or renew your San Antonio Botanical Garden Membership, please Create an Account. ... Designed By. Sited on rolling topography with views of downtown San Antonio, this 38-acre botanical garden opened in 1980 after decades of planning and advocacy by the San Antonio Garden Center. Located approximately three miles northeast of downtown, the site once housed a reservoir (today an amphitheater) used by George Brackenridge’s San ...
